We had a wonderful experience! The itinerary was really good and our CEOs Luke and Ronald were the best. There?s two things I didn?t like though. 1. Please just include all the meals during the tour and make the tour more expensive. Not including meals in places like Bwindi where there is no other restaurant option and you?re forced to eat at the lodge you?re staying at anyway is just pointless and annoying as you have to calculate the money you have to withdraw from ATMs and ends up costing you more because of high ATM fees! Either include all meals or do a breakfast/dinner included lunch optional system for people who don?t want to eat lunch 2. Kigali View Hotel. Can?t believe G Adventures picks this hotel as end point and recommends it to its guests! It was really bad. The food was horrible, the rooms smelled, the bathroom smelled. Luckily it was only one night so it was bearable but for people who wanna end on a high or who decided to stay longer that Hotel is a full disappointment! And if you decided to keep it as your end point at least clearly label it as VERY BUDGET and recommendations for nicer hotels in the area.

Having recently completed the Primates and Wildlife of Uganda trip, we woukd thoroughly recommend it. We were so close the chimpanzees and gorillas, that even now it is hard to believe that we have been in such close proximity to these amazing mammals. We were very impressed with our guide Julius, who was very attentive and informative. Nothing was too much trouble for him. We were also so fortunate enough to see lions, antelope, buffalo, elephants, hippos, wild pigs, warthogs, crocodile, monkeys, and much birdlife. It was an excellent trip, no regrets at all.
